An Advanced Certificate in Mathematical Modelling is increasingly significant for population dynamics forecasting, a crucial area in today’s UK market. Accurate population projections are vital for effective resource allocation in healthcare, education, and infrastructure planning. The UK Office for National Statistics (ONS) projects a rise in the elderly population, with those aged 65 and over expected to comprise 24% of the total population by 2043, up from 19% in 2022. This demographic shift necessitates sophisticated population dynamics modelling to anticipate future demands and optimize service provision.
